Stevenson School is a PK-12 co-educational, college-preparatory boarding and day school with enrollment of 750 students on two campuses in beautiful Central Coast California. The Upper Division campus (Grades 9-12) is located in Pebble Beach. The Lower/Middle Divisions Campus (Grades PK-8) is in nearby Carmel‑by‑the‑Sea. Stevenson is a mission‑driven school that aims to help students shape joyful lives while instilling a passion for learning and achievement to prepare them for success in school and beyond.

Stevenson School is seeking an Associate Teacher, Lower Division to start July 2026. The Associate Teacher position is designed as a one to three year placement that prepares aspiring and early‑career educators for a lead teacher position. The program offers an immersive experience in an elementary or early childhood classroom. Working alongside a lead teacher who serves as a mentor, associate teachers have the opportunity to hone lesson planning and classroom management skills, practice and develop pedagogical approaches appropriate to small group and whole class instruction to meet the needs of each student, and participate in ongoing curriculum development across academic subjects.

Associate teachers will engage in ongoing professional development offered to all lower division faculty in areas such as social‑emotional learning and Responsive Classroom as well as training opportunities specifically geared to early‑career educators.

The associate teacher program is ideally suited to aspiring educators who have recently completed education degree programs (bachelor’s or master’s level) or have completed a degree in a related academic field and have meaningful experience working with children between the ages of 5‑12.
